It's HTC's turn to release their newest flagship smartphone of 2017. That's the HTC U 11 a successor to the last year HTC 10, with unusual Edge-Sense feature and highest-rated camera on an smartphone.
In terms of the design, unlike its competitors Galaxy S8 and LG G6 with 'bezel-less' display, the U 11 seems going into different direction here. But, it has an unique feature called 'Edge-Sense' where you can squeeze the phone to launch Google Assistant and the camera app.
The HTC U 11 has a 5.5-inch '2k' resolution display @ 534ppi and it's protected with Gorilla Glass 5. Internally, it has an SnapDragon 835 SoC, up to 6GB of RAM, up to 128GB of expandable storage, and Adreno 540 GPU.
It's also the newest smartphone with highest-rated camera ever according to DXomark test. It's got an 12MP rear camera w/ f/1.7 aperture, OIS, PDAF, and dualtone LED flash. While 16MP in front-facing camera.
Battery-wise, it has a 3000mAh non-removable Li-lon battery with Quich Charge 3.0.
HTC U 11 Specs
Operating System | Android Nougat 7.1.1 / MIUI 8 |
---|---|
Display | 5.5-inch 1440x2560 @ 534ppi Super LCD Gorilla Glass 5 |
CPU | Octa-core SnapDragon 835 |
GPU | Adreno 540 |
RAM | 4GB/6GB |
ROM | 64GB/128GB |
Main camera | 12MP f/1.7, OIS, PDAF, Dual LED flash Video : [email protected] |
Selfie camera | 16MP |
Connectivity | Wi-Fi dual band, Wi-Fi direct, DLNA, hotspot, Bluetooth 4.2, A-GPS, Glonass, BDS |
Battery | Li-lon 3000mAh non-removable Quick Charge 3.0 |
Feature | IP67 water and duat resist, HTC BoomSound, Amazon Alexa, 3D Audio recording (four microphones) |
Sensors | Accelerometer, Proximity, Gyroscope, Compass, Fingerprint scanner (front-mounted) |
Price | $749 |
